Monotonic Simplification and Recognizing Exchange Reducibility

In [BM4] the Markov Theorem Without Stabilization (MTWS) established the existence of a calculus of braid isotopies that can be used to move between closed braid representatives of a given oriented link type without having to increase the braid index by stabilization. Although the calculus is extensive there are three key isotopies that were identified and analyzed—destabilization, exchange moves and elementary braid preserving flypes. One of the critical open problems left in the wake of the MTWS is the recognition problem— determining when a given closed n-braid admits a specified move of the calculus. In this note we give an algorithmic solution to the recognition problem for three isotopies of the MTWS calculus—destabilization, exchange moves and braid preserving flypes. The algorithm is “directed” by a complexity measure that can be monotonic simplified by that application of elementary moves.
